Just a reminder on this compiler issue.

I tested today the impact of the proposed patch changing compiler
options for AWT on my machine (i7 gcc 4.8.4):

Without patch (clean build - client libs):
EllipseTests-fill-true.ser                       1    25    445.220
445.336    445.196    0.127    444.944    445.543    25

With patch:
EllipseTests-fill-true.ser                       1    26    402.889
403.861    403.134    0.446    402.603    404.294    26

The impact is very important on this test (large mask fills) ~ 10%

Sergey, could you check on gcc 4.9.2 ?
